OXY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2016 in Review

1,043 of the 3,753 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Occidental Petroleum (OXY) for Q1 2016, worth a combined $41.7B — down 3.2% from $43B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 99 funds opened new OXY positions and 78 closed out — a net gain of 21 holders — while 433 added to existing stakes and 489 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Royal London Asset Management, adding an estimated $832M. The largest seller was Institutional Capital, exiting entirely with an estimated $298M sold.
